Top 5 Battlefield Commander Games on Android in Europe: Q2 2022 Performance

The second quarter of 2022 saw notable trends across the top Battlefield Commander games on the Android platform in Europe. Here's a closer look at the performance of the leading apps in this category.

Clash Royale from Supercell experienced fluctuating weekly revenue, peaking at approximately $1M in the week of April 4. Weekly downloads showed a downward trend, starting from 272K in late March and dropping to 136K by the end of June. The game's active user base also saw a decline, moving from 27.3M to 22.2M over the quarter.

MAD PIXEL GAMES LTD's Epic Army Clash, released in early April, showed an impressive increase in weekly downloads early on, peaking at 104K in the week of April 25. However, downloads gradually decreased to around 16K by the end of June. Active users followed a similar trend, rising to 163K in late April and then declining to 99K by the end of June.

Castle Raid! from VOODOO, despite its June release, showed stable weekly revenue around $400-$750. The game had a strong start in weekly downloads, reaching 40K in early June but dropping to 27K by the end of the month. Active users saw a peak of 225K in early June, followed by a decline to 190K by the end of the quarter.

Grow Castle - Tower Defense by RAON GAMES maintained consistent weekly revenue around $2.4K-$3.1K. Downloads showed a significant drop, starting at 38K in late March and falling to 11K by the end of June. Active users also decreased from 181K to 81K over the same period.

Age of War 2 from Max Games Studios exhibited stable weekly revenue around $350-$470. Downloads fluctuated, peaking at 35K in early May and then stabilizing around 25K towards the end of June. Active users saw an increase from 39K in late March to a high of 64K in early May, before settling around 50K by the end of June.
